Building and Grounds Supervisor jobs in Canton, OH

Building and Grounds Supervisor supervises and trains building and grounds maintenance staff. Oversees landscaping activities, the maintenance of sidewalks and parking areas, and the removal of trash and snow. Being a Building and Grounds Supervisor maintains and monitors the operation of all utility systems such as heating, ventilating and air conditioning. May be responsible for the housekeeping staff. Additionally, Building and Grounds Supervisor, a level I supervisor is considered a working supervisor with little authority for personnel actions. Requ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Working team member that may validate or coordinate the work of others on a support team. Suggests improvements to process, is a knowledge resource for other team members. Has no authority for staff actions. Generally has a minimum of 2 years experience as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of the team process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• General Summary:

    Under general supervision performs a variety of unskilled manual labor tasks designed to maintain the cleanliness and safe conditions of the Belmont County offices and buildings; may act as night security; other duties as required. In addition, may be required to drive to other County facilities, work in the Mailroom, and lock/unlock County facilities.

    Essential Duties:

    1. Performs general custodial duties in the offices and buildings of Belmont County – 80%

    • Custodial cleaning and maintenance of assigned building and all rooms, baths, offices, halls, doors, and auxiliary areas. Sweeps, mops, scrubs, strips, waxes, polishes and buffs floor surfaces and stairwells. Vacuums rugs and carpeting. Operates floor cleaning and polishing equipment. Cleans equipment after use and perform maintenance as required.
    • Cleans windows. Cleans and dusts chairs, tables, counters, pictures, clocks and other fixtures/furniture. Cleans and empty trash receptacles.
    • Cleans and sanitizes restroom facilities and maintains adequate supply of hand towels, toilet tissues, and feminine hygiene supplies. Cleans sinks, glass and mirrors, etc. Visually inspects areas for cleanliness.
    • May change light bulbs in offices.
    • May be required to drive to multiple County facilities to perform various custodial tasks. May have to fill-in in the Mailroom. May have to lock/unlock County facilities.

    2. Other Custodial Tasks – 15%

    • Shampoos rugs and carpets. Washes walls and woodwork. Loads and/or unloads trucks. Delivery of same to proper locations.
    • Assists in grounds maintenance and operation of related equipment (trash pickup, snow removal, spreading salt, mowing grass, etc.).
    • Assists in transporting of chairs and tables for various meetings. May raise and lower U.S. flag as requested.

    3. Other Tasks – 5% of time spent

    • Performs related duties as assigned.

Canton (/ˈkæntən/) is a city in and the county seat of Stark County, Ohio, United States. Canton is located approximately 60 miles (97 km) south of Cleveland and 20 miles (32 km) south of Akron in Northeast Ohio. The city lies on the edge of Ohio's extensive Amish country, particularly in Holmes and Wayne counties to the city's west and southwest. Canton is the largest municipality in the Canton-Massillon, OH Metropolitan Statistical Area, which includes all of Stark and Carroll counties.
